Location That Actually Matters
Here’s what I love about this spot — you can walk to Juliet’s balcony in about three minutes, but you’re not stuck in the middle of tourist chaos. The street is quiet enough that you’ll actually sleep well, yet bustling Piazza delle Erbe is just around the corner. Couples absolutely rave about this location (they’ve rated it 9.7, which honestly makes sense), and I get why. You can stroll to dinner along cobblestone streets, then walk it off exploring the Roman amphitheater without ever needing transportation. Practical Perks
You know what’s actually useful? They have private parking available, which — if you’ve ever tried to park in Verona’s old town — is basically like finding gold. Most people don’t realize how tricky it can be to navigate these narrow medieval streets with a car, so having that option takes away a major headache. The staff seems to genuinely know the area well, and they’ll point you toward the best local spots rather than just the obvious tourist traps.
